Quick facts: Mountain pine, AR
Overview for Mountain pine, AR
Mountain Pine is a charming city located in Garland County, Arkansas. Nestled near the Ouachita National Forest, it offers a serene and picturesque setting characterized by lush greenery and scenic landscapes. With a population of around 1,300 residents, Mountain Pine boasts a tight-knit community atmosphere. The city is well-known for its outdoor recreational opportunities, including hiking, fishing, and camping, thanks to its proximity to lakes and nature trails. Local attractions include the picturesque Lake Ouachita, one of the largest lakes in the state, which is perfect for water sports and relaxation. The area also hosts various community events throughout the year, fostering a strong sense of local pride and community spirit. The economy in Mountain Pine primarily revolves around small businesses and tourism, capitalizing on the natural beauty of the surrounding area. Education is served by the Mountain Pine School District, which focuses on providing quality education to its students. Overall, Mountain Pine offers a peaceful lifestyle with a blend of outdoor adventure and community engagement, making it an inviting place for residents and visitors alike.
